I had the cubase sx2 for sometimes but I've never used it before because I always afraid of its complication but today I've intalled it agai and import some wav file to it and use some of cubase effects...and man!it sound whole different!I use effects in reason but these effects are something else.
now tell me please with wich software "sequncer" can I use cubase effects?since reason doesn't host plugins.I mean an easy to work sequencer(like acid maybe)

you can route your audio material from reason to cubase via rewire and then apply the wanted vst fx.. read an article sometime where it was said that e.g. alexander kowalski and others do this to get the finial touch to their reason arrangements..
